What is actually Form 8300?
Form 8300 is a file utilized in the USA to report money remittances going beyond $10,000 received in a field or service purchase. The primary aim of this kind is to deal with loan laundering as well tax relief services as income tax dodging by offering the internal revenue service along with information about sizable cash money transactions.
Who Needs to File Form 8300?
Any business or person that gets over $10,000 in cash money must submit Form 8300. This includes:
- Retailers Service providers Real estate agents Car dealerships
If you approve money payments and also fulfill this limit, it's your obligation to submit this form.

When an organization gets more than $10,000 in cash money for products or even services, they must finish and provide Kind 8300 to the IRS within 15 times of getting the settlement. The kind records important details regarding the purchase, consisting of:
- The quantity of cash received The date of the transaction The label and address of the payer
Filing Criteria for Form 8300
To guarantee observance with internal revenue service guidelines, particular submission needs should be fulfilled:
Time Structure for Filing
professional tax relief servicesAs stated earlier, Form 8300 should be actually submitted within 15 times after acquiring over $10,000 in cash money. Failing to accomplish so can lead to large fines.
Where to File
Form 8300 could be submitted electronically with the IRS e-file body or even posted straight to the IRS at the handle specified on the form.
Recordkeeping Obligations
Businesses should always keep a duplicate of each submitted application along with supporting records for 5 years from the day of filing.
